When Monitored:
•
Amplifier BUS wake-up. Amplifier reset with scan tool.
•
Set Condition:
•
The amplifier detects an open condition on the speaker output circuit.
Possible Causes
(X209)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ER (+) CIRCUIT OPEN
(X299)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ER (-) CIRCUIT OPEN
LEFT FRONT I/P SPEAKER
AMPLIFIER
Diagnostic Test
1.
CHECK FOR AN INTERMITTENT CONDITION
Turn the ignition on.
Turn the radio on.
With the scan tool, erase Amplifier DTCs.
With the scan tool, reset the amplifier.
With the scan tool, read Amplifier DTCs.
Does the scan tool display active: B1463-CHANNEL 1 AUDIO SPEAKER OUTPUT CIRCUIT OPEN?
Yes
>> Go To 2
No
>> The conditions that caused this code to set are not present at this time. Using the wiring diagram/sche-
matic as a guide, inspect the wiring and connectors.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
2.
CHECK THE OPERATION OF THE LEFT FRONT I/P SPEAKER
Disconnect the Left I/P Speaker harness connector.
Turn the radio on and turn the volume to mid level.
With a voltmeter set to read in A/C voltage, measure the voltage of the
Amplified Left I/P Speaker circuits in the Amplified Left I/P Speaker har-
ness connector.
Is the voltage present greater than 1 volt?
Yes
>> Replace the Amplified Left I/P Speaker in accordance with
the service information.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
No
>> Go To 3

3.
CHECK THE (X209)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ER (+) CIRCUIT FOR AN OPEN
Turn the ignition off.
Disconnect the Amplifier C1 harness connector.
Measure the resistance of the (X209) Amplified Left I/P Speaker (+) cir-
cuit between the Amplifier C1 harness connector and the Amplified Left
I/P Speaker harness connector.
Is the resistance below 5.0 ohms?
Yes
>> Go To 4
No
>> Repair the (X209) Amplified Left I/P Speaker (+) circuit for
an open.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
4.
CHECK THE (X299)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ER (-) CIRCUIT FOR AN OPEN
Turn the ignition off.
Disconnect the Amplifier C1 harness connector.
Measure the resistance of the (X299) amplified Left I/P Speaker (-) cir-
cuit between the Amplifier C1 harness connector and the Amplified Left
I/P Speaker harness connector.
Is the resistance below 5.0 ohms?
Yes
>> Replace the Amplifier in accordance with the service infor-
mation.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
No
>> Repair the (X299) Amplified Left I/P Speaker (-) circuit for
an open.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.

B1464-CHANNEL 1 AUDIO SPEAKER OUTPUT CIRCUIT SHORTED TOGETHER
For a complete wiring diagram Refer to Section 8W.
PM
AUDIO/VIDEO SYSTEMS- ELECTRICAL DIAGNOSIS
8A - 47
•
When Monitored:
•
With the ignition on. Radio volume at 25 or higher.
•
Set Condition:
•
The amplifier detects that the output circuits are shorted together.
Possible Causes
(X209)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ER (+) CIRCUIT SHORTED TO THE (X299) A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ER
(-) CIRCUIT
A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ER
AMPLIFIER
Diagnostic Test
1.
CHECK FOR AN INTERMITTENT CONDITION
Turn the ignition on, then off, and then on again.
With the scan tool, erase Amplifier DTCs.
Turn the radio on.
Turn the volume level to 25.
With the scan tool, read Amplifier DTCs.
Does the scan tool display active: B1464-CHANNEL 1 AUDIO SPEAKER OUTPUT CIRCUIT SHORTED
TOGETHER?
Yes
>> Go To 2
No
>> The conditions that caused this code to set are not present at this time. Using the wiring diagram/sche-
matic as a guide, inspect the wiring and connectors.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
2.
CHECK THE OPERATION OF THE AMPLIFIED LEFT I/P SPEAKER
Disconnect the Amplified Left I/P Speaker.
Measure the resistance of the speaker between the two terminals.
Is the resistance of the speaker less than 1 ohm?
Yes
>> Replace the Amplified Left I/P Speaker in accordance with
the service information.
Perform BODY VERIFICATION TEST VER-1.
No
>> Go To 3
